Address: 16635 Hollister St Suite B, Houston, TX 77066, USA
“Loved my experience here. The staff is very hospitable and the owner really makes you feel taken care of. Helped with my deductible and got the work done relatively quick.”
1 million customers
find businesses on BusinessYab every month.
500 businesses
join BusinessYab every day.
BusinessYab helps you…